• DocumentCode
    1847018
  • Title

    Enhanced truncated differential cryptanalysis of GOST

  • Author

    Courtois, Nicolas T. ; Mourouzis, Theodosis ; Misztal, Michal

  • Author_Institution
    Department of Computer Science, University College London, Gower Street, London, U.K.
  • fYear
    2013
  • fDate
    29-31 July 2013
  • Firstpage
    1
  • Lastpage
    8
  • Abstract
    GOST is a well-known block cipher implemented in standard libraries such as OpenSSL, it has extremely low implementation cost and nothing seemed to threaten its high 256-bit security [CHES 2010]. In 2010 it was submitted to ISO to become a worldwide industrial standard. Then many new attacks on GOST have been found in particular some advanced differential attacks by Courtois and Misztal with complexity of 2179 which are based on distinguishers for 20 Rounds. In July 2012 Rudskoy et al claimed that these attacks fail when the S-boxes submitted to ISO 18033-3 are used. However, the authors failed to consider that these attacks need to be re-optimized again for this set of S-boxes. This is difficult because we have exponentially many sets of differentials. In this paper we present a basic heuristic methodology and a framework for constructing families of distinguishers and we introduce differential sets of a special new form dictated by the specific regular structure of GOST. We look at different major variants of GOST and we have been able to construct a distinguisher for 20 round for CryptoParamSetA and similar results for the new version of GOST submitted to ISO which is expected to be the strongest (!). Therefore there is absolutely no doubt that these versions of GOST are also broken by the same sort of attacks.
  • Keywords
    Ciphers; Complexity theory; Encryption; Entropy; ISO Standards; Aggregated Differentials; Block Ciphers; Differential Cryptanalysis; Distinguisher; GOST; Gauss Error Function; ISO 18033-3; S-boxes; Sets of Differentials; Truncated Differentials;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Security and Cryptography (SECRYPT), 2013 International Conference on
  • Conference_Location
    Reykjavik, Iceland
  • Type

    conf

  • Filename
    7223192